Bol-anon Goodies!

We just got back from Bohol and since my parents are from there, I knew what to get for pasalubong.  I want to feature some of the yummy products that I bought and will use some of the items I bought for a few recipes in the future. Bohol Bee Farm - I had to stop myself from getting all of the items from the store. These goodies are great, healthy and cost efficient!     Yummy Pesto Spread, wonderful on toast or crackers!   This Honey Spread wasn't so bad. You don't really get the same taste as when you put butter and honey on toast.
